An update to municipal spending and revenue (June 2019)

An update to municipal spending and revenue (June 2019)

South Africa’s 257 municipalities spent a total of R101,3 billion in the second quarter of 2019 (April to June). This is the first time that quarterly municipal spending has breached the R100 billion mark. Municipal bucket toilet use continues to decline

Municipal bucket toilet use continues to decline

The number of consumer units using municipal bucket toilets fell from 60 557 in 2017 to 42 612 in 2018. This represents a 29,6% decrease in a single year, according to the latest Non-financial census of municipalities report. In 2014, the total was 85 718. Setsoto

Setsoto Local Municipality is situated in the Eastern Free State within the boundaries of the Thabo Mofutsanyane District Municipality. The local municipality area measures 5 948,35 km2 and comprises four urban areas namely Ficksburg/Meqheleng, Senekal/Matwabeng, Marquard/Moemaneng and Clocolan/Hlohlolwane, as well as some surrounding rural areas.

Mafube

The Mafube Local Municipality is one of the local municipalities found within the Fezile Dabi District Municipality. The municipality was established in terms of section 12 of the Municipal Structures Act, 1998, following the local government elections of 2000.

The municipality is made up of four towns, namely Frankfort, Villiers, Cornelia and Tweeling. Frankfort serves as a home for the headquarters of the municipality.

Midvaal

Midvaal Local Municipality is an administrative area in the Sedibeng district of Gauteng. The name was given due to its geographical location. Midvaal lies between Johannesburg and the East Rand and the Vaal River and Vereeniging.
